#[non_exhaustive]
pub struct Probe { pub agent: Agent, pub bin: String, pub reported: String, pub version: Option<Version>, pub verified: Version, pub status: VersionStatus, }
Expand description

What an installed agent CLI reported about itself.

Fields (Non-exhaustive)§

This struct is marked as non-exhaustive
Non-exhaustive structs could have additional fields added in future. Therefore, non-exhaustive structs cannot be constructed in external crates using the traditional Struct { .. } syntax; cannot be matched against without a wildcard ..; and struct update syntax will not work.
§agent: Agent

The agent probed.

§bin: String

The binary that answered.

§reported: String

Its --version output, trimmed.

§version: Option<Version>

The version read out of that output, if one could be.

§verified: Version

The release this crate’s mappings were verified against.

§status: VersionStatus

How the two relate.

Implementations§

Source§

impl Probe

Source

pub async fn run(agent: Agent) -> Result<Probe>

Ask agent’s default binary for its version.

§Errors

Error::NotInstalled if the binary is missing, Error::Spawn if it cannot be run.

Source

pub async fn run_bin(agent: Agent, bin: &str) -> Result<Probe>

Ask a specific binary for its version, for a caller that overrides the path with crate::Request::bin.

§Errors

Error::NotInstalled if the binary is missing, Error::Spawn if it cannot be run.

Source

pub fn advisory(&self) -> Option<String>

A sentence explaining a non-verified version, or None when it matches.

Written to be shown to a person: it says what was found, what was expected, and what that means for them.
